oUR SIMPLE BUYING PROCESS

Step #1 What is your motivation for buying a home? Are you tired of paying rent, are you upgrading from your existing home. Determine what you want and what you need from your new home. Outlining these important factors will make the decision process easier down the road. Our knowledgeable realtors can help you determine what’s realistic to expect in your specific area, within your budget. Next Step » define your goals Step #2 With an investment as big as purchasing your home, you’ll want to make sure you have a trusted professional at your side. Whether you’re buying your first home or your 5th, You’ll want to choose someone who is knowledgeable about your specific Vermont area and is experienced in the purchasing and negotiating process. Having an agent who has your best interests at heart can help easy your stress and make it a much smoother experience. Next Step » Choose An Agent Step #3 You’ll want to know your budget up front. This can save you time and stress down the road and will help narrow your search. Talking to a mortgage professional, and possibly getting pre-approved for your mortgage can be a very helpful step in understanding how much you will want to spend on your new home. Your RE/MAX North Professional agent can help point you towards a reputable, local Vermont lender. Next Step » Determine Your Budget Step #4 Once you find a home that you’re interested in buying, your agent can help you determine a fair offer based on comparable homes in the immediate area. If your offer is accepted you will be officially under contract on your new home! This is called the due-diligence period where you will want to review the conditions and obligations of your contract before signing the closing documents. Your agent can also offer valuable guidance through the inspection and appraisal process before closing. Next Step » make an offer Step #5 Closing is the final step in the home-buying process. This is where you’ll sign official documentation and mortgage paperwork to finalize ownership of the property and you will receive the keys to you new property. Congratulations – You are officially the owner of your new home! Next Step » Closing
